Definition

Pronunciation: //ˈmænɪdʒ//

verb

  • (transitive) To direct or be in charge of.
    "Even though Jack is a novice, he manages his team with great success."
  • (transitive) To handle or control (a situation, job).
    "The government managed the inflation very poorly."
  • (transitive) To handle with skill, wield (a tool, weapon etc.).
    "It was so much his interest to manage his Protestant subjects."
  • (intransitive) To succeed at an attempt in spite of difficulty. [with infinitive]
    "He managed to climb the tower."

noun

  • (now rare) The act of managing or controlling something.
    "the winged God himſelfe Came riding on a Lion rauenous, Taught to obay the menage of that Elfe […]."
  • (equestrianism) Manège.
    "You must draw [the horse] in his career with his manage, and turn, doing the corvetto, leaping &c.."

What's the difference between Scrabble and Words With Friends points?

While many letters share the same point values, there are several key differences between Scrabble and Words With Friends point values:

  • B, C, M, P: Worth 3 points in Scrabble, but 4 points in Words With Friends
  • H, Y: Worth 4 points in Scrabble, but 3 points in Words With Friends
  • L, N, U: Worth 1 point in Scrabble, but 2 points in Words With Friends
  • V: Worth 4 points in Scrabble, but 5 points in Words With Friends
  • J: Worth 8 points in Scrabble, but 10 points in Words With Friends

Note: These are base letter values. Actual game scores also depend on bonus squares (Double/Triple Letter/Word) and board placement, which differ between the two games. See the complete Scrabble point values and Words With Friends point values for full reference.
